Made in collaboration with the Huber brothers, the new Quantum is based around the design of an older Five Ten shoe of the same name that was a particular favourite of the German duo. The biggest update to this model was to make the last slightly wider giving a flatter and overall more comfortable shape to the shoe. In addition, the toe box has been brought to more of a point and a stiff midsole ensures great performance on edges as the shoe can easily maintain its shape when put under pressure. The shoe's slight downturn will help on steeper routes without hampering the user on face climbs or slabs. Comfort is a key feature of the Quantum with a soft, synthetic upper and a perforated tongue which ensures good breathability on longer routes or in hot conditions. The final big plus point for the Quantum is the speed lacing which allows you to easily adjust the shoe on the wall or in-between climbs.
